The Science Behind a Lush Lawn

The key to achieving a lush lawn lies in understanding the factors that contribute to its health. Water, sunlight, soil quality, and mowing techniques are the primary elements that determine the success of your lawn. When these factors are in balance, your lawn will thrive, but when they are compromised, brown patches can develop.

The soil is the foundation of a healthy lawn, and its quality is crucial in determining the types of grass that can grow. Different types of grass require different soil conditions, and it's essential to choose the right one for your area. Soil pH, nutrient levels, and drainage are also critical factors that need to be considered.

Common Causes of Brown Patches

Brown patches can be caused by a variety of factors, including drought, overwatering, nutrient deficiencies, and pests. Drought can cause the grass to turn brown due to a lack of water, while overwatering can lead to root rot and kill the grass. Nutrient deficiencies, such as lack of nitrogen, phosphorus, or potassium, can also cause brown patches.

Pests such as lawn grubs, billbugs, and chinch bugs can damage the grass and create brown patches. Weeds can also compete with the grass for water and nutrients, leading to brown patches. A combination of these factors can exacerbate the problem and make it challenging to fix.

The good news is that fixing brown patches is achievable with the right techniques and solutions. Here are 7 simple fixes that can help you achieve a lush lawn:

  • Water deeply but infrequently to encourage deep root growth
  • Aerate the soil to improve drainage and air circulation
  • Fertilize with a balanced fertilizer to address nutrient deficiencies
  • Adjust your mowing technique to prevent damaging the grass
  • Overseed with a mix of grass species to thicken the lawn
  • Use a soil test kit to determine the pH and nutrient levels of your soil
